Meet your team

Our vision is to build the next generation Unified Business Network, bringing all our business networks together into a single business platform to create a network of networks, a network of intelligent enterprises, leveraging on their respective capabilities to enable a new way of how companies engage with each other. SAP Business Network represents a strategic investment and fast-growing area, with a strong and leading cloud portfolio on top of SAP Cloud Platform. The SAP Business Network brings together the world’s largest trading partner community with more than $600B of commerce flowing through and more than 1.7 million businesses in 190 countries around the world, with a new business joining our Procurement and Supply Chain Networks every two minutes. We cover multiple locations around the world, we bring together a diverse team of talents.


What you'll do

  • Research existing features, analyze the impact of proposed changes, and contribute to scope discussions.
  • Gather and understand complex requirements from client requests and internal initiatives.
  • Has a keen understand and passion for Supply Chain and Procurement business processes.
  • Understand the technical implementation behind new features.
  • Collaborate with teams including Development, User Experience, Quality Assurance, Implementation, Account Services and Sales to ensure high quality solutions.
  • Lead design sessions to define the new project, uncover and resolve potential issues, and validate that the solution both fits the original request and is a quality product enhancement for all clients.
  • Create and maintain functional requirements, tables, diagrams, and supporting documents.
  • Provide post-release support when internal resources have questions.

What you bring

  • Comprehensive knowledge of the SAP Business Network application.
  • Minimum of a b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Services, Information Technology, Business Administration, or other discipline industry related.
  • 3 years of experience working as a Business Analyst supporting software development projects, preferably in VMS, Cloud and/or SAAS solution.
  • Strong analytical skills, excellent communication, and presentation skills demonstrated ability to translate client requirements into system functionality.
  • Ability to multitask on diverse requirements in a fast-paced environment and stay flexible as solutions or requirements change.
  • Understanding of business systems and Software development Lifecycle and techniques.
  • Experience working directly with a software development team.
  • Advanced experience in Confluence and JIRA
  • Has aptitude to be in front customers and good presentation skills
  • Experience in SQL queries, data analysis and summarizing findings.
  • Passion to build great products and to solve customer and business problems.


We build breakthroughs together

SAP innovations help more than 400,000 customers worldwide work together more efficiently and use business insight more effectively. Originally known for leadership in en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, SAP has evolved to become a market leader in end-to-end business application software and related services for database, analytics, intelligent technologies, and experience management. As a cloud company with 200 million users and more than 100,000 employees worldwide, we are purpose-driven and future-focused, with a highly collaborative team ethic and commitment to personal development. Whether connecting global industries, people, or platforms, we help ensure every challenge gets the solution it deserves. At SAP, we build breakthroughs, together.
